I recently setup the list recommended in this (http://forums.peerblock.com/read.php?3,17085) the I-blocklist discussion thread.
It seems to black-list 0.0.0.0.
Windows 10 seems to use 0.0.0.0 when the computer comes out of stand-by/sleep mode. If it cannot send these packets, then it puts the Internet connection into a non-functioning state.
The trouble is, that white-listing 0.0.0.0 doesn't work. PeerBlock blocks it anyway.
It's not practical to edit the list, since in theory it's a URL that's supposed to be updated on a regular basis.
